The South East England / Sussex region

On the edge of the proposed South Downs National Park and in the Chichester Harbour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ty, Itchenor is an ideal location to explore with plenty of culture with Chichester Theatres and Art Galleries, Stately Homes and Gardens. Portsmouth is nearby, the home of the Royal Navy with Nelson's flagship HMS Victory, HMS Warrior and the Mary Rose - historic ships and dockyard for all to explore. Shopping in the Georgian city of Chichester or the modern Gunwharf Quays in Portsmouth. Blue Flag sandy beaches for all ages to enjoy with separate dog friendly beaches plus the seaside resorts of Brighton, Hastings and Eastbourne as well as the historic towns of Rye and Arundel - this area has much to offer visitors.

West Sussex offers excellent walking, cycling, yachting and horseracing (Goodwood)

East Sussex is home to the rolling South Downs and the 'long man' a 69-foot chalk drawing on the hillside. Sussex is within easy reach of London.


Chichester / Itchenor area

Itchenor is situated 6 miles from the City of Chichester with its Cathedral, Festival Theatre and many shops and restaurants. It is well situated for visting many local attractions:-

Goodwood Racecourse and Motor Racing Circuit, with the Festival of Speed and Revival Meetings.
Fishbourne Roman Palace and Museum
Portsmouth with hits Historic Naval Dockyard, Gunwharf Shopping and Spinnaker Tower
The Weald and Downland Open Air Museum
West Dean House and Gardens
Kingly Vale and Pagham Harbour Nature Reserves
Chichester Harbour - guided walks, activities and boat trips
Many beaches, including East Head and West Wittering's long sandy beach
Many Historical Houses including Arundel Castle, Goodwood House, Uppark and Petworth House

There are opportunities for sailing, windsurfing, kite surfing, fishing, kayaking, harbour tours aboard a solar powered boat, golf, bird watching and wonderful walks and cycle paths.

Havant Station is 15 minutes drive away for trains to London which take 75 minutes to Waterloo. There are regular trains to Brighton with all its attractions, 40 minutes away. Day trips by ferry to the Isle of Wight or Cherbourg in France can be taken from Portsmouth which is a 30 minute drive away.

The village of Itchenor has several pubs, The Ship which is a few yards from the Itchenor Harbour area and serves excellent food and real ales and The Lamb also serving excellent food with live music. Both are within easy walking distance of the cottage.

At Dell Quay, a couple of miles from Itchenor, stunning views of the estuary can be experienced from The Crown & Anchor along with great food, served all day. This pub is on the cycle path that runs from the cottage.

At the village of Bosham there are several pubs to chose from, one being The Anchor Bleu that overlooks the water and serves good food and real ales. Excellent meals can also be enjoyed at the Millstream Hotel, a short walk away. You can either drive here or walk/cycle and catch the passenger ferry from Itchenor harbour to Bosham harbour.
